Vorlage:QuellenAusgabe: Unterschied zwischen den Versionen

Aus Splitterwiki
Zur Navigation springen Zur Suche springen
K (Textersetzung - „|sep=“ durch „|valuesep=“)
(test Lua Quellenausgabe)
Markierung: Ersetzt
 
(2 dazwischenliegende Versionen von einem anderen Benutzer werden nicht angezeigt)
Zeile 1: Zeile 1:
 
<h2>Quellen</h2>
 
<h2>Quellen</h2>
  
<!--
+
{{#invoke:Quellen|getQuellen|Pagename={{FULLPAGENAME}}}}
-->{{#if: {{#ask: [[-Hat Unterobjekt::{{FULLPAGENAME}}]] [[Typ::Gesamtquellen]] }}<!--
 
 
 
  --><!-- START Quellendarstellung auf Basis des subobjects vom Typ "Gesamtquellen"
 
 
 
  -->|{{Textbaustein Quellen Legende}}<!--
 
    -->{{QuellenAngaben}}<!--
 
    --><ul><!--
 
    -->{{#arrayprint: QuellenAngaben <!--
 
      -->| <hr> <!--
 
      -->| @@@@ <!--
 
      -->| <li>@@@@</li><!--
 
      -->}}<!--
 
      --></ul><!--
 
 
 
  --><!-- ENDE Quellendarstellung auf Basis des subobjects vom Typ "Gesamtquellen"
 
 
 
  --><!-- START Quellendarstellung auf Basis einzelner subobjects vom Typ "Quelle"
 
 
 
  -->|{{#arraymap: <!--
 
    -->{{#ask: [[Kategorie:Publikation]] [[Hauptkategorie::Publikation]] [[Offiziell::Ja]]<!--
 
      -->|valuesep=@//@<!--
 
      -->|limit=500<!--
 
      -->|link=none<!--
 
      -->}}<!--
 
    -->|@//@<!--
 
    -->|@@@@<!--
 
    -->|<!--
 
 
 
      -->{{#vardefine: Zeichenkette |{{#replace:@@@@|[|<nowiki> </nowiki>}}}}<!--
 
      -->{{#vardefine: Zeichenkette |{{#replace:{{#var:Zeichenkette}}|]|<nowiki> </nowiki>}}}}<!--
 
      -->{{#vardefine: Zeichenkette |{{#explode: {{#var:Zeichenkette}}|{{!}}|0}}}}<!--
 
      -->{{#vardefine: AnmerkungPup| <!--
 
        -->{{#ask:[[Publikation::{{#var: Zeichenkette}}]] [[-Has subobject::{{FULLPAGENAME}}]] <!--
 
          -->|?AnmerkungPublikation=<!--
 
          -->|mainlabel=-<!--
 
          -->}}<!--
 
        -->}}<!--
 
 
 
      -->{{#vardefine:Ausgabe<!--
 
        -->|{{#ask:[[Publikation::{{#var: Zeichenkette}}]] [[-Has subobject::{{FULLPAGENAME}}]] <!--
 
          -->|?SeiteZahl<!--
 
          -->|?Zusatz<!--
 
          -->|?Anmerkung<!--
 
          -->|mainlabel=-<!--
 
          -->|valuesep=, <!--
 
          -->|format=list<!--
 
          -->| sort=SeiteZahl<!--
 
          -->|order=ascending<!--
 
          -->|template=TemplateQuelle<!--
 
          -->}}<!--
 
        -->}}<!--
 
 
 
      -->{{#vardefine: AnmerkungPup |{{#replace:{{#var:AnmerkungPup}}|,|<nowiki> </nowiki>}}}}<!--
 
 
 
      -->{{#if:{{#var:Ausgabe}}<!--
 
        -->|@@@@<!--
 
          -->{{#ifeq: {{#var:AnmerkungPup}}|<!--
 
            -->|{{#var:AnmerkungPup}}<!--
 
            -->|&nbsp;({{#var:AnmerkungPup}})<!--
 
            -->}}<!--
 
          -->: {{#var:Ausgabe}}<br><!--
 
        -->|<!--
 
        -->}}<!--
 
 
 
    -->|<!--
 
    -->}}<!--
 
 
 
  --><!-- ENDE Quellendarstellung auf Basis einzelner subobjects vom Typ "Quelle"
 
 
 
  -->}}<!--
 
-->
 

Aktuelle Version vom 26. Februar 2024, 22:26 Uhr

Quellen

Lua-Fehler in Modul:Quellen, Zeile 15: bad argument #1 to 'getn' (table expected, got nil)